Wanderlust: Whenever a cottage/village/town upgrades, it moves to a random adjacent tile.

Bondsman: Any player currently in a war which you are not involved in can cast a spell which costs them (and gives to you) 50 gold per city you own and forces you to declare war on all their enemies. Any player at war with you can cast a spell which grants you 75 gold per city you own that forces you to declare peace.

Agoraphobia: All of your units auto-acquire a Blindness promotion upon leaving your (or your teamates) territory, except workers.


Hermit: None of your units can share the same tile


Tea Lover: Every 5th turn you are not allowed to do anything at all. Cities are in anarchy condition and units are held. (slightly better would be that the timer is on a per-unit/per-city basis, every 5th turn since created. Then each turn you still get to do something, but on average 20% of your civ is unavailable)

Child-friendly Entertainer: All of your units have a CityBonus type of promotion which grants happiness in nearby cities not under your control, but also reduces diplomatic relations with that civilization.

Eccentric: Every unit you produce has an even chance of being any UU (or the basic unit) of that unitclass instead of what you tried to actually build.

Addled: Every unit you produce has a 10% chance of instead being a chicken.


Instructor: All your units start with 1 free promotion (like Adepts, you can choose 1 promotion, or in the case OF adepts, 1 extra free promotion)


Contractor: 500% bonus to unit production, but all units are created with a 20 turn duration.
